What is the Coterminal angle of 30 degrees?

Coterminal angles: are angles in standard position (angles with the initial side on the positive x-axis) that have a common terminal side. For example, the angles 30°, –330° and 390° are all coterminal (see figure 2.1 below).

How do you find a Coterminal angle of 120 degrees?

For example, angles measuring 120° and – 240° are coterminal. There are infinitely many coterminal angles. One way to find the measure of an angle that is coterminal with an angle θ is to add or subtract integer multiples of 360°.

How do you find Coterminals?

Coterminal Angles are angles who share the same initial side and terminal sides. Finding coterminal angles is as simple as adding or subtracting 360° or 2π to each angle, depending on whether the given angle is in degrees or radians.

Are angles 315 and Coterminal?

Coterminal Angles are angles in standard position that have the same Initial Side and the same Terminal side. For example 45°, 405° and -315° are coterminal angles because all three angles have the same initial side (the x axis) and they share a same terminal side.

  • How to find terminal angles?

    Coterminal angles are angles in a standard position that have the same terminal sides. Every angle has an unlimited number of coterminal angles. Given ∠θ in standard position with measurement xn, then the angle measures that are coterminal to the angle are given by the formula ∠θ = x° + 360°n. Take note that n is an integer.
